Redis热点Key发现及常见解决方案是怎样的
Redis热点Key发现是指在Redis数据库中发现存在大量读写操作的key,这些key会对Redis的性能造成负面影响。Redis热点Key的发现是一个比较复杂的过程,它需要对Redis进行深入的分析,以检测出存在大量读写操作的key,并采取有效的措施来解决这些问题。
Redis热点Key发现的常见解决方案有:
1、数据库分片:将热点key放到不同的数据库中,以减少热点key对Redis性能的影响。
2、使用缓存:为热点key设置缓存,以减少对Redis的访问,提高Redis的性能。
3、使用消息队列:将热点key的读写操作放入消息队列中,以减少Redis的压力。
4、使用锁机制:在Redis中使用锁机制,以防止多个客户端同时访问热点key,从而减少对Redis的压力。
5、使用Redis集群:使用Redis集群可以将热点key分布到多台服务器上,从而减少单台服务器的压力。
6、优化代码:优化热点key的读写操作,减少对Redis的访问,从而提高Redis的性能。
7、使用Redis Sentinel:使用Redis Sentinel可以监控Redis的状态,以及发现热点key,并采取有效的措施来解决这些问题。
以上就是Redis热点Key发现及常见解决方案的一些介绍,希望能够帮助到大家。
相关文章